This is Jacob. In October, we got a call from a sweet employee at the local rec center about a kitten that she was worried would be hit by a car in the heavily trafficked area. One of our foster families took him home and realized that he is just terrified of people. We have worked with him for the last few months and he is now a lot more brave! He is out during the day, but still panics if we surprise him or corner him accidentally. He enjoys being held and petted once you get ahold of him. He is hoping for a quiet home with a family patient enough to continue bringing him out of his shell. He is around a year old and is neutered and up to date on his shots. He is not a fan of little kids or crazy dogs. Do you have room in your home for a timid, but precious baby?
All of our kittens and cats are spayed/neutered, vaccinated, dewormed, tested for FeLV/FIV (negative results unless indicated), received booster vaccine and has had their rabies vaccine prior to going into their forever homes.
